**🚨📰 BREAKING NEWS LIVE – LIVERPOOL CONSIDER £75M EMERGENCY MOVE FOR ANTOINE SEMENYO | SKY SPORTS REPORT**

 

Reports emerging on **October 22, 2025**, have suggested that **Liverpool** are considering a sensational **£75 million January move** for **Bournemouth forward Antoine Semenyo**, as the club looks to address a concerning dip in **Mohamed Salah’s form**.

 

According to **The iPaper**, later picked up by several reputable outlets, Liverpool’s recruitment team is now seriously exploring options for an **emergency attacking reinforcement** ahead of the winter transfer window. Sources close to the club indicate that discussions have already taken place internally about the feasibility of triggering Semenyo’s release clause, believed to be around **£75 million**.

 

The 25-year-old Ghanaian forward has been one of Bournemouth’s standout players this season, earning plaudits for his **pace, power, and relentless pressing style** — qualities that align perfectly with **Arne Slot’s high-intensity tactical system** at Liverpool. Semenyo’s direct approach and physicality have made him a nightmare for defenders, and he notably **scored twice against Liverpool** in the opening match of the current Premier League campaign, leaving a strong impression on the Anfield hierarchy.

 

Liverpool’s growing concern stems from a **noticeable dip in Mohamed Salah’s performances** over recent weeks. The Egyptian winger, who has been the club’s talisman for several years, has struggled to replicate his usual sharpness and goal-scoring consistency this season. With the **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ON)** approaching early next year, Liverpool could also face the possibility of losing Salah for a crucial part of the campaign — adding further urgency to their search for attacking depth.

 

However, a major advantage in targeting Semenyo is that **Ghana failed to qualify for AFCON 2025**, meaning the forward would remain available throughout the tournament period. This availability makes him an even more appealing option for Liverpool’s January plans.

 

There’s also an intriguing **personal link** in the potential transfer. **Liverpool’s sporting director, Richard Hughes**, previously held the same role at Bournemouth and was instrumental in signing Semenyo for the Cherries. Hughes’ familiarity with the player’s qualities, professionalism, and development could play a key role in accelerating negotiations between the two clubs.
